Product Description

Description

The 6SN1112-1AB00-1BA0 is a SIMODRIVE 611 capacitor module specifically engineered to provide energy support and stabilization for the DC link in industrial drive systems. With a capacitance of 4.1 mF, this module is designed to bridge brief power fluctuations and assist in energy management during high-demand motor operation phases, ensuring consistent voltage stability within the SIMODRIVE 611 drive configuration.

This module is housed in a standard IP20-rated enclosure, making it suitable for mounting within industrial control cabinets. It is a critical component for maintaining system efficiency and protecting drive hardware from potential voltage-related instability. As an integral part of the SIMODRIVE 611 series, this unit is currently in the Phase-Out stage of its lifecycle.

Installation Guidelines

  • Placement: The module must be installed in close proximity to the SIMODRIVE 611 drive line-up to minimize impedance on the DC link connection.
  • Mounting: Use the integrated mounting points to secure the module vertically in the control cabinet, ensuring adequate clearance for thermal dissipation.
  • Interconnection: Ensure all DC link busbar connections are tightened to the torque specifications provided in the SIMODRIVE 611 system manual to prevent arcing and high-resistance joints.
  • Safety: Always discharge the DC link fully before handling or maintaining the capacitor module, as stored energy can pose a significant electrical shock hazard.
